比如这道题:
有一个长度为 n 的初始所有元素都为 0 的数组和一个整数 k,你可以对这个数组进行这样的操作:选择一个长度为 k 的区间 [l, r],其中 1 <= l <= r <= n,将这个区间所有的数加1。
现在给你一个长度为 n的数组和一个整数 k,判断这个数组能否经过有限步操作从初始数组得到。如果可以,输出操作的次数,如果不行,输出 -1。
可以发现数组能否由初始数组得到和+1操作的顺序无关,请问大佬们像这种情况下会怎么考虑呢?